Author: davsclaus
Date: Wed Jul 20 13:36:03 2011
New Revision: 1148762
URL: http://svn.apache.org/viewvc?rev=1148762&view=rev
Log:
Fixed ftp tests fails on windows. Made test more resilient on what os it runs
due line terminators diffs
Modified:
camel/trunk/camel-core/src/test/java/org/apache/camel/component/file/strategy/FileChangedReadLockTest.java
camel/trunk/camel-core/src/test/java/org/apache/camel/component/file/strategy/MarkerFileExclusiveReadLockStrategyTest.java
camel/trunk/components/camel-ftp/src/test/java/org/apache/camel/component/file/remote/FtpChangedReadLockTest.java
Modified:
camel/trunk/camel-core/src/test/java/org/apache/camel/component/file/strategy/FileChangedReadLockTest.java
URL:
http://svn.apache.org/viewvc/camel/trunk/camel-core/src/test/java/org/apache/camel/component/file/strategy/FileChangedReadLockTest.java?rev=1148762&r1=1148761&r2=1148762&view=diff
==============================================================================
---
camel/trunk/camel-core/src/test/java/org/apache/camel/component/file/strategy/FileChangedReadLockTest.java
(original)
+++
camel/trunk/camel-core/src/test/java/org/apache/camel/component/file/strategy/FileChangedReadLockTest.java
Wed Jul 20 13:36:03 2011
@@ -48,7 +48,8 @@ public class FileChangedReadLockTest ext
String[] lines = content.split("\n");
assertEquals("There should be 20 lines in the file", 20, lines.length);
for (int i = 0; i < 20; i++) {
- assertEquals("Line " + i, lines[i]);
+ // there may be windows line terminators
+ assertTrue(lines[i].startsWith("Line " + i));
}
}
Modified:
camel/trunk/camel-core/src/test/java/org/apache/camel/component/file/strategy/MarkerFileExclusiveReadLockStrategyTest.java
URL:
http://svn.apache.org/viewvc/camel/trunk/camel-core/src/test/java/org/apache/camel/component/file/strategy/MarkerFileExclusiveReadLockStrategyTest.java?rev=1148762&r1=1148761&r2=1148762&view=diff
==============================================================================
---
camel/trunk/camel-core/src/test/java/org/apache/camel/component/file/strategy/MarkerFileExclusiveReadLockStrategyTest.java
(original)
+++
camel/trunk/camel-core/src/test/java/org/apache/camel/component/file/strategy/MarkerFileExclusiveReadLockStrategyTest.java
Wed Jul 20 13:36:03 2011
@@ -59,7 +59,8 @@ public class MarkerFileExclusiveReadLock
content = context.getTypeConverter().convertTo(String.class, new
File("target/marker/out/file2.dat").getAbsoluteFile());
lines = content.split("\n");
for (int i = 0; i < 20; i++) {
- assertEquals("Line " + i, lines[i]);
+ // there may be windows line terminators
+ assertTrue(lines[i].startsWith("Line " + i));
}
waitUntilCompleted();
Modified:
camel/trunk/components/camel-ftp/src/test/java/org/apache/camel/component/file/remote/FtpChangedReadLockTest.java
URL:
http://svn.apache.org/viewvc/camel/trunk/components/camel-ftp/src/test/java/org/apache/camel/component/file/remote/FtpChangedReadLockTest.java?rev=1148762&r1=1148761&r2=1148762&view=diff
==============================================================================
---
camel/trunk/components/camel-ftp/src/test/java/org/apache/camel/component/file/remote/FtpChangedReadLockTest.java
(original)
+++
camel/trunk/components/camel-ftp/src/test/java/org/apache/camel/component/file/remote/FtpChangedReadLockTest.java
Wed Jul 20 13:36:03 2011
@@ -50,7 +50,8 @@ public class FtpChangedReadLockTest exte
String[] lines = content.split("\n");
assertEquals("There should be 20 lines in the file", 20, lines.length);
for (int i = 0; i < 20; i++) {
- assertEquals("Line " + i, lines[i]);
+ // there may be windows line terminators
+ assertTrue(lines[i].startsWith("Line " + i));
}
}